Abstract
Based on the annual living Euonymus kiautschoicus and Euonymus japonicas, by different density of NaCl solvent irrigation to the seeding root, to analyze effect of different density of solvent on photosynthesis. The results showed that (1) The MDA volume of Euonymus kiautschoiccus and Euonymus japomnicus raising up with NaCl density going up; MDA volume gets the peak at the circumstance of 2.5% NaCl salt stress, and compared with CK, the Euonymus kiautschoicus towers over 132%, Euonymus japonicas towers over 118%;(2)After the salt stress, the proline volume of the Euonymus kiautschoiccus and Euonymus japomnicus turns out the bigger density of NaCl solvent, the more the accumulation of pralines; (3)According to the analysis of variance, the Euonymus kiautschoiccus in the NaCl 1.5%salt stress, the growth turns out to be weakening, however, under NaCl 2.0%salt stress, the Euonymus japomnicus turns out to be good, in the circumstance of over NaCl 2.0%, the growth turns out weakening. In summary, the author considers that the salt resistance of Euonymus japomnicus is better than Euonymus kiautschoiccus, and Euonymus japomnicus is suitable for planting in saline-alkali soil.关键词
